Plugger is a multimedia plugin for Unix Netscape 3.0 or later that
handles Quicktime, MPEG, MP2, AVI, SGI-movie, Tiff, DL, IFF-anim,
MIDI, Soundtracker, AU, WAV and Commodore 64 audio files. Since
Plugger 3.0, MPEG audio and video can be streamed.
Plugger is a very small plugin, because plugger uses external programs
to show/play the different formats.
HTMLgen is a class library for the generation of HTML documents with
Python scripts. It's used when you want to create HTML pages
containing information which changes from time to time. For example
you might want to have a page which provides an overall system summary
of data collected nightly. Or maybe you have a catalog of data and
images that you would like formed into a spiffy set of web pages for
the world to browse. Python is a great scripting language for these
tasks and with HTMLgen it's very straightforward to construct objects
which are rendered into consistently structured web pages. Of course,
CGI scripts written in Python can take advantage of these classes as
well.
A library that can be used to add OpenID support to Django
applications. The library integrates with Django's builtin
authentication system, so most applications require minimal changes to
support OpenID login.
The library also includes the following features:
* Basic user details are transfered from the OpenID server via the
Simple Registration extension.
* It can be configured to use a fixed OpenID server URL, for use in
single sign on deployments.
* It supports the Launchpad teams extension to request team
membership information.
